Valley of the Dinosaurs is an animated television series from the Australian studios of Hanna-Barbera that ran for 16 half-hour installments on CBS Saturday Morning from September 7, 1974 to September 4, 1976. Reruns are currently airing on the Boomerang network.

  1. 1. Forbidden FruitThe Butlers and Tana are gathering fruit that looks like an orange. Gorok and Lok come by and tell them to leave the fruit. It is reserved for a Brontosaurus. At that moment the Brontosaurus shows up hungry for the fruit. Everyone leaves the fruit except Greg. He sneaks it back with him to the cave. The Brontosaurus finishes all the fruit and even the leaves on the tree. He smells the fruit that Greg took and follows them back to their cave. The Brontosaurus causes a cave in while trying to get into the cave to get the last of the fruit. They are all trapped in the cave. The cave starts to fill with water from an underground river. Greg and Tana find a way out and scare the Brontosaurus away with a landslide of rocks. In the meantime, the others are siphoning the water out with a bamboo tube to buy some time. Greg drops a vine down through a hole in the ceiling and saves all of them.CC30minSep 7, 1974
